Abstract
Explicit formulae for the densities of the first hitting times to the sphere of Brownian motions with drifts are given. We need to consider the joint distributions of the first hitting times to the sphere and the hitting positions of the standard Brownian motion and explicit expression for their Laplace transforms are given, which are different from the known formulae in the literature and are of independnt interest.
